Norah Alonizan is an academic researcher from University of Dammam. The author has contributed to research in topics: Nanoparticle & Electromagnetic shielding. The author has an hindex of 10, co-authored 32 publications receiving 385 citations. Previous affiliations of Norah Alonizan include King Abdulaziz University & King Saud University.

Characterizations of multilayer ZnO thin films deposited by sol-gel spin coating technique

TL;DR: In this paper, a zinc oxide (ZnO) multilayer thin films are deposited on glass substrate using sol-gel spin coating technique and the effect of these multi-layer films on optical, electrical and structural properties are investigated.

Structural, electrical and optical properties of multilayer TiO 2 thin films deposited by sol–gel spin coating

TL;DR: In this article, a multilayer thin film of TiO 2 has been applied on a glass substrate by using sol-gel spin coating technique and the optical properties of the films were measured by UV-Vis spectroscopy which showed the high transmittance in the visible region.

Radiation shielding, structural, physical, and optical properties for a series of borosilicate glass

TL;DR: In this article, the effect of BaO content on the shielding, optical, structural, and physical features of 10TiO2-10SiO2-(80-x)B2O3-xBaO (10≤ ǫx  ≤ 30) glass samples for their ability to be used as radiation shielding substances was explored.
